Advantage Energy Ltd. (TSE:AAV – Get Free Report) (NYSE:AAV) has earned a consensus rating of “Moderate Buy” from the nine brokerages that are currently covering the firm, MarketBeat Ratings reports. Two investment anal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ating, six have given a buy rating and one has given a strong buy rating to the company. The average 12 month price objective among brokerages that have issued ratings on the stock in the last year is C$13.63.
AAV has been the topic of a number of research analyst reports. TD Cowen reaffirmed a “buy” rating and issued a C$14.00 target price on shares of Advantage Energy in a report on Friday, May 2nd. Desjardins raised their price objective on Advantage Energy from C$13.50 to C$14.00 and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a research report on Monday, May 5th. Royal Bank of Canada raised their price objective on Advantage Energy to C$11.00 and gave the stock a “hold” rating in a research report on Wednesday, April 9th. National Bankshares upgraded Advantage Energy from a “sector perform” rating to an “outperform” rating and raised their price objective for the stock from C$11.50 to C$15.00 in a research report on Thursday, January 30th. Finally, Cormark upgraded Advantage Energy to a “moderate buy” rating in a research report on Thursday, March 6th.

Advantage Energy Stock Performance
AAV opened at C$10.32 on Monday. The firm has a market capitalization of C$1.71 billion, a P/E ratio of 37.58,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of -3.58 and a beta of 1.46. The stock’s 50 day moving average price is C$9.98 and its two-hundred day moving average price is C$9.55. The company has a quick ratio of 0.72, a current ratio of 0.75 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 41.40. Advantage Energy has a 12-month low of C$7.81 and a 12-month high of C$11.73.
Advantage Energy Company Profile
Advantage Energy Ltd supplies clean, affordable, reliable, and sustainable Canadian energy to power the needs of Canada and the world. It is focused on the development and delineation of its Montney natural gas and liquids resource at Glacier, Wembley/Pipestone, Valhalla, and Progress, Alberta.
